Graciela name meaning:

The name Graciela is of Spanish origin, deriving from the Latin word "gratia" which means grace or favor. It is the Spanish diminutive form of the name Grace, signifying "little Grace" or "endowed with grace." Origin: Latin

Favor, blessing. The three mythological graces were nature Goddesses: Aglaia: (brilliance); Thalia: (flowering); and Euphrosyne: (joy).
